John Entwistle, Zak, John “Rabbit” Bundrick and Gary Nuttall perform at a concert at Abbey Road Studios
Pete starts selling items from his Lifehouse shows at Sadler’s Wells and Scoop artwork at his merchandise site.
CNN’s Showbiz Today carries a sound clip from Pete
The Los Angeles Times prints an interview with Pete
Roger and John are interviewed by Gary Graff for MusicDirect.com. John says he hopes the new Who album will be “a lot more up-tempo, up-front. I’ve said that before , and I usually end up with the only rock ‘n’ roll songs on the album.”
Pete has an online chat through barnesandnoble.com
The Dropkick Murphy’s Mob Mentality is released with a cover of “The Kids Are Alright”. Listen to it on YouTube here
Redline Entertainment releases the CD Lifehouse Elements at Best Buy stores
Sherie Rene Scott releases her CD Men I’ve Had featuring covers of The Who and Pete Townshend
